How Mike Veny Shows Self Kindness & Why You Should Too
Self Kindness is important. As a mental health speaker, I spend a lot of time sharing with others how to protect their mental health and emotional wellness. Learning how to be kind to yourself is an important part of mental health and self-care. But as someone who can easily switch into “perfectionism mode”, I’m not always kind to myself.
There are two simple things that you can do to start practicing self kindness right away:
Forgive yourself.
Stick to the “good enough” rule
In this video, I share specific examples of what these self kindness tips look like in my own life.
If you’re struggling with stress, perfectionism, anxiety, or other mental or emotional health challenges, these two simple tips can help you be kind to yourself today.

How to Stay Sane Working from Home in a Pandemic – QUICK RELIEF
How to stay sane working from home – what you really want to know is how to stay sane working from home in a pandemic. In this video, Mike Veny will give you 5 tips on working from home effectively.
Like you, he’s been working from home during the pandemic and has developed specific strategies to keep him mentally well. As a mental health in the workplace speaker, he’s learned to deliver presentations from his home and has become a Certified Virtual Presenter.
While this video doesn’t address topics like how to balance homeschool and work, it still offers you general guidance for working from home with kids.
Mike Veny’s tips on working from home include taking breaks, stretching, asking for what you need from others, getting out of the house and sitting with your feelings. This is the beginning of how to work from home efficiently and how to focus when working from home.
* Oftentimes we forget to take breaks during our workday (or even stop working at the end of the day).
* Stretching doesn’t require a gym and can be done almost anywhere.
* Asking for what you need from others is difficult whether you are living through a pandemic or not.
* Getting out of the house is important and needs to be done safely (wearing a mask and social distancing).
* Learning to sit with your feelings is hard, especially when it comes to difficult emotions like anger, grief and fear.
Pandemic aside, these are some great remote working tips that will help you with remote working time management. Applying these to your life will help you to maintain your sanity as we navigate this pandemic.
